Git: пытается объединить ветви, но есть множество конфликтов, и большинство из них / не должно быть конфликтов - PullRequest
1 голос
/ 15 марта 2012

Вот многое из того, что я получаю:

<<<<<<< HEAD
code
=======
>>>>>>> Merge branch 'master' of code_url into not_master

и есть множество таких, которые встречаются несколько раз в 40+ файлах. Есть ли другой способ слияния, чтобы он самостоятельно разрешал конфликты? Я чувствую, что всякий раз, когда он сталкивается с какой-либо одновременной разницей в расположении файла, git решает перевернуть ВСЕ ТАБЛИЦЫ.

(╯ ° □ °) ╯︵ buıbɹǝɯ ʇıb

Я посмотрел на rebase, и он МОЖЕТ быть тем, что мне нужно, когда я запускаю ветку. Чтобы начать ребазинг - мне все еще нужно разобраться со всеми этими конфликтами.

Ответы [ 2 ]

1 голос
/ 15 марта 2012

Я часто видел это, когда git записывал удаляемые строки.Кажется, не требуется автоматическое слияние, если строка была отредактирована в одной ветви, но удалена в другой.

0 голосов
/ 15 марта 2012

Вы проверили, есть ли различия в конце строки?Вышесказанное может происходить от окончания строки \r в репо и \n в рабочем каталоге.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...